What a reload actually is

A reload is a deposit bonus for members who already have an account. The percentage follows whatever campaign is live in the 7Gear cashier and is typically lower than the welcome rate — fair enough, since it repeats. Some campaigns anchor to specific days, like start-of-week or weekend promos.

The mechanics mirror the first-deposit bonus: extra balance locked behind wagering until the requirement is cleared.

Daily vs weekly rhythm

Daily offers tend to be small with light requirements — built for regulars. Weekly ones are bigger but demand heavier wagering. Pick the rhythm that matches how often you actually play; claiming everything just because it exists is how budgets evaporate.

Reloads vs the other 7Gear promos

Against the welcome bonus, a reload is smaller but more honest: you already know the 7Gear cashier, you know how you play, and you can judge whether the terms fit. Against cashback, a reload demands action up front — deposit first, bonus second — while cashback simply accrues from whatever you were doing anyway.

The most comfortable combination for a regular player usually looks like this: claim a reload only on days you already planned to deposit, let cashback and rebates run silently in the background, and skip any offer that would change how you play. A good promotion adapts to you — never the other way around.

Weekly reload offers

A weekly reload is a deposit bonus that resets on a fixed day each week — often start-of-week or weekend at 7Gear. The weekly reload usually carries a larger percentage than a daily one but a heavier wagering target to match, which makes it best suited to players who deposit in bigger, less frequent chunks. Claim the weekly reload only on a day you already planned to top up, and let it be a bonus on activity you were doing anyway rather than a reason to deposit more.

Reload terms to check

Before claiming, read the reload terms in the cashier: the match percentage, the wagering multiple, the claim limit per day or week, and any excluded deposit methods. Reload terms are tracked separately from other active bonuses, so a reload will not interfere with wagering you are already clearing. The binding reload terms are always the ones published on the offer at the moment you opt in, not last month's version.

Min deposit for a reload

Every reload has a min deposit — the smallest top-up that triggers the bonus. Deposit below the min deposit and the offer simply will not apply, so confirm the figure in the promo before sending funds. The 7Gear min deposit for reloads is kept modest, but it can differ between a daily and a weekly campaign, so check the min deposit each time rather than assuming last week's number still holds.
